- Cardamom is a highly aromatic spice known for its unique flavor and fragrance. It belongs to the ginger family and is native to India, Nepal, and Bhutan.
- There are two main types of cardamom: green cardamom and black cardamom, both of which are used in different cuisines and dishes.
- Green cardamom (Elettaria cardamomum) is the most common variety and is widely used in sweet and savory recipes.
- It has a strong, sweet, and slightly spicy flavor with floral undertones. Green cardamom pods contain small black seeds that are used for cooking.
- The pods are usually lightly crushed or opened to release the aromatic seeds before using them in recipes.
- Green cardamom is a versatile spice used in a variety of dishes. It is often included in desserts like rice pudding, pastries, and Indian sweets.
- It is also a key ingredient in many spice blends, such as garam masala and chai masala. In savory dishes, green cardamom is used in curries, rice dishes, stews, and marinades, lending a delightful fragrance and flavor.
